Advanced Strapping Head Technology: Seal vs. Seal-less Joints
The heart of any strapping machine is its strapping head, responsible for tensioning, sealing, and cutting the strap. Fhope incorporates state-of-the-art head technology, offering solutions that move beyond traditional methods. Market analysis, often featured in technical journals, shows a clear trend towards seal-less joint technologies for improved reliability and cost-efficiency.
- Traditional Seal Joints: Utilizes separate metal seals crimped onto the overlapping strap ends. While established, this method requires maintaining seal inventory and can sometimes result in lower joint efficiency compared to modern alternatives.
- Interlock (Notch) Joints: This seal-less method employs successive punches to mechanically lock the overlapping strap ends together. Fhope's interlock heads achieve robust joint efficiencies, typically around 85% of the strap's breaking load, eliminating the need for seals. This aligns with findings reported in packaging engineering studies focusing on joint strength consistency.
- TIG Welding Joints: Representing the pinnacle of strap joining technology, Tungsten Inert Gas (TIG) welding creates a permanent, high-strength bond. The TIG Welding Advantage in Steel Coil Strapping
Fhope’s implementation of TIG welding technology in its strapping heads provides distinct operational and safety benefits, drawing parallels with advancements discussed in high-tech manufacturing contexts:
- Superior Joint Efficiency: Consistently achieves joint strengths exceeding 90% of the strap's nominal breaking load, offering maximum security for heavy and valuable coils. This high efficiency is corroborated by mechanical testing data comparing various joining methods (as per data analogous to that found in material strength research).
- Elimination of Consumable Seals: Reduces operational costs, simplifies inventory management, and eliminates a potential point of failure.
- Zone affectée par la chaleur minimale (ZAT) : The non-contact electric arc and inert gas shielding minimize heat transfer to the coil surface, crucial for protecting sensitive coatings (e.g., galvanization, paint) from damage. This precise thermal control is a key benefit often cited in advanced welding technique patents.
- Enhanced Stacking and Handling Safety: The resulting weld is flat and smooth, significantly reducing the risk of snagging during handling or stacking, thereby preventing strap breakage and potential injuries.
- Optimized for High-Tensile & Stainless Steel: Performs exceptionally well with modern high-tensile and stainless steel straps, materials increasingly used for demanding applications.
- Conformité aux normes mondiales : TIG welded joints meet stringent international transport and safety regulations, including AAR (Association of American Railroads) approval for specific configurations, ensuring suitability for global logistics.
